图形绘制
使用迷你编程软件(如Scratch、Code.org等),通过拖拽积木块的方式编写程序,控制图形在屏幕上移动、改变颜色等。这种方式可以帮助理解编程基础概念,同时培养创造力和逻辑思维能力。
编写小游戏
利用迷你编程的图形化界面,编写一些简单的小游戏,如弹球游戏、贪吃蛇等。通过编写游戏,可以运用编程技巧,如条件判断、循环等,同时增加对编程基本概念的理解。
制作动画
利用迷你编程的动画功能,创作出自己的动画作品。通过调整图形的位置、大小和颜色,表达创意,并学习如何运用变量、函数等编程概念。
设计交互界面
在迷你编程中创建交互界面,设计程序并与用户进行互动。例如,创建一个简单的计算器,让用户输入数字进行计算,并输出结果。这种实践可以提高编程逻辑和问题解决能力。
构建机器人
迷你编程支持与一些机器人硬件的连接,如LEGO Mindstorms、mBot等。通过编写控制机器人的程序,让机器人完成一些基本任务,如前进、转向等。这种方式将编程与实际操作相结合,培养动手实践和创造力。
参与编程比赛或挑战
迷你编程平台通常会举办一些编程比赛或挑战活动。通过参与这些活动,可以与其他编程爱好者交流和竞争,不断提高编程技能,并获得实践经验。
可视化编程工具
使用可视化编程工具(如Scratch、Blockly等),通过拖拽和连接代码块的方式,学习编程的基本逻辑和算法。这些工具适合初学者学习编程的基本概念和思维方式。
微控制器编程
利用微控制器和电子模块(如Arduino、Micro:bit等),学习编程和电子基础知识。通过编写程序控制电子模块实现各种功能,培养动手能力和创造力。
Web编程
学习使用HTML、CSS、JavaScript等Web开发技术,通过编写网页和交互性的网页应用程序,学习编程的基本概念和技能。这种方式适合对网页设计和开发感兴趣的学习者。
通过尝试这些玩法,你可以逐步掌握迷你编程的技巧,并享受编程带来的乐趣。建议从简单的项目开始,逐步增加难度,以更好地理解和应用编程知识。